The CERN@school Programme: MoEDAL Grid User Guide

This document provides a guide for those associated with the MoEDAL Collaboration who wish to use the Worldwide LHC Computing Grid (WLCG) resources for collaboration activities, including (but not limited to) running simulations, storing experimental and simulated data, and analsying the results for publication.  The guide is largely based on a similar guide written for the UK's GridPP Collaboration that covers a suite of software tools and infrastructure developed or adopted for the benefit of user communities new to the Grid, namely GridPP DIRAC, Ganga, and CernVM.  It focusses largely on running GEANT4 simulations of the MoEDAL experiment, with the MoEDAL software deployed with the CernVM File System (CernVM-FS or CVMFS), job and data management with the GridPP DIRAC instance, and Ganga (running on a CernVM) as the Grid User interface.
